      Abstract

      research Abstract

      September 2017 in “Plastic and reconstructive surgery. Global open”
      This study found that follicular unit transplantation is an effective and minimally invasive technique for camouflaging scarring alopecia in the head and neck area, achieving a graft survival rate of 86% and high patient satisfaction.

      Autologous Micrografts from Scalp Tissue in Treatment of Androgenetic Alopecia

      research Autologous micrografts from scalp tissue in treatment of androgenetic alopecia

      July 2024 in “International Journal of Dermatology Venereology and Leprosy Sciences”
      This study observed that techniques using autologous cellular micrografts to isolate hair follicle stem cells from scalp biopsies show promise in improving hair density and thickness for androgenetic alopecia, offering a minimally invasive and potentially more compliant alternative to existing treatments like finasteride and minoxidil.

      research SAT-369 Marine-Lenhart Syndrome: Case Report

      October 2025 in “Journal of the Endocrine Society”
      This case report documented the management of a 46-year-old female with Marine-Lenhart syndrome, combining antithyroids with minimally invasive sclerotherapy to achieve euthyroidism and reduce thyroid nodule size by 58%.
